Overview
CY8C5268AXI-LP047 from Infineon Technologies (formerly Cypress) is a 32-bit programmable System-on-Chip (PSoC® 5LP) integrating Arm® Cortex®-M3 CPU, configurable analog/digital peripherals, 256 KB flash, 64 KB RAM, and CapSense® support. It operates from 1.71–5.5 V across –40 to +85 °C, delivers up to 80 MHz performance, and supports USB 2.0 Full-Speed, I²C, SPI, and PWM functions in industrial HMI and sensor fusion systems.
For engineers reviewing the CY8C5268AXI-LP047 datasheet, CY8C5268AXI-LP047 pinout, CY8C5268AXI-LP047 application, or CY8C5268AXI-LP047 equivalent, key selection criteria include its 68-pin QFN package, 24-channel DMA, 12-bit SAR ADC with 1.024 V reference, low-power sleep modes (2 µA), and flexible UDB-based peripheral synthesis capability.
Technical Context
The device implements a tightly coupled architecture where the Arm Cortex-M3 core interfaces directly with a programmable digital subsystem built around 24 Universal Digital Blocks (UDBs), enabling custom logic synthesis including UART, SPI, PRS, CRC, and quadrature decoders without external components. Its analog subsystem integrates a 12-bit SAR ADC, dual comparators, 8-bit DAC, and CapSense® engine supporting up to 62 sensors.
Clock management includes a 3–74 MHz internal main oscillator (2% accuracy at 3 MHz), PLL for up to 80 MHz operation, four independent clock dividers, and dedicated low-power oscillators (1/33/100 kHz ILO, 32.768 kHz WCO). Power delivery features a boost regulator (0.5–5 V output) and six independent power domains for fine-grained voltage control.

FAQ
Does CY8C5268AXI-LP047 support USB device enumeration without external crystal?
Yes. The device includes an internal oscillator qualified for USB 2.0 Full-Speed (12 Mbps) operation per TID#10840032, eliminating the need for an external 48 MHz crystal. This reduces BOM cost and board space while maintaining USB compliance across temperature and voltage ranges.
What is the maximum number of CapSense® sensors supported on this device?
CY8C5268AXI-LP047 supports up to 62 self-capacitance or mutual-capacitance sensors using its dedicated CapSense® CSD v3.0 hardware block. Sensor count is limited only by available GPIOs and scan time budget, with automatic baseline tracking and noise rejection built into firmware libraries.
Can the 12-bit SAR ADC operate simultaneously with USB activity?
Yes. The ADC and USB subsystems operate independently with separate clock domains and DMA channels. Concurrent operation is verified in PSoC Creator™ with example projects demonstrating simultaneous 1 Msps ADC sampling and USB bulk transfers without data loss or timing violation.
Is there hardware support for secure boot or firmware encryption?
The device includes flash security features such as read protection, write protection, and secure bootloader support via protected memory regions. While it lacks AES hardware acceleration, cryptographic operations can be implemented in firmware using protected flash and NVLs for key storage, meeting IEC 62443-3-3 SL1 requirements.
